Subject #237 (Andrik) notes:

Subject #237 has displayed a willful and aggressive nature since his capture three months ago. There has been more than one report of his having attacked a scientist or an assistant. As of now he hasn’t seriously injured anyone, however. Considering the subjects feral nature when he was captured such aggression is not unexpected. What is unexpected is his rapid development of language skills. The subject already speaks English as if he had been doing it his whole life. Where as most feral children never fully learn to speak, if at all. On the day of his arrival at the facilities #237 was especially hostile, attacking anyone that got close to him. We were prepared to tranquilize the subject when another subject, #223, approached him. We were panicked, #223 is our best subject and we didn’t want to see her injured by what promised to be a mediocre subject at best. Contrary to our fears, however, subject #237 embraced subject #223. We have puzzled over the recordings of their first encounter many times. As yet we haven’t determined if there was any form of exchange between the two. Perhaps it was just an instinctual response to a female from #237? Regardless subject #223’s test scores have increased dramatically since the arrival of subject #237. Subject #237 himself has scored above and beyond our expectations. Still the obvious bonding between the two is subject of great debate. Some insist the two should be separated out of fear that subject #237 will eventually lash out at subject #223. Others claim that separating them would cause subject #237 to lash out at everyone. With subject #237’s volatile nature I believe he will lash out no matter what we do. So I’ve decided to wait until we’re sure the mental constraints have taken hold before we make any firm decision on the matter and to allow the two subjects to continue as they will. Not very surprisingly none of the other subjects have taken a liking to #237 and generally avoid him.

Subject #223 (Andreasa) notes:

The acquisition Subject #223 four months ago was a great boon to our studies. The subject has proved exceptionally gifted. The subject has also been exceptionally compliant, performing tests without the slightest complaint. Subject #223 was located in a foster facility so perhaps her time in child services has made the subject more accepting of adverse situations? Her bonding with Subject #237 would defiantly support this theory. Before the arrival of subject #237, subject #223 spent her free time interacting with the other subjects, playing, conversing, and other such juvenile activities. Now, however, she spends all her free time with subject #237. Often the pair can be found in a room by themselves reading a text book of some kind. Subject #237 has a voracious curiosity which subject #223 seems more than happy to indulge has she has to do most of the reading. (In spite of his language skills subject #237 is a poor reader at best.) The situation between #223 and #237 has created a bit of a stir among the other subjects who are apparently jealous of subject #237’s monopolization of subject #223. We would intervene, but there is concern for how #237 would react. Additionally the correct view of the situation is that subject #223 is monopolizing subject #237. The other subjects are simply unwilling to be near #237 just to spend time with #223.

Andrik and Andreasa looked up at the same time as the orderlies entered the room. There were six of them all together and they made a half circle around the front of the couch the pair were sitting on. Andreasa slowly closed the book and set it to one side as the men parted slightly to make room for Dr. Kadrid. “Having fun?” the doctor asked with a smile. “What do you want?” Andrik asked in response. Though his voice was calm there was an edge to it, it was the way he spoke to everyone besides the girl beside him. Andreasa gently laid a hand on Adric’s shoulder and looked up at Dr. Kadrid saying, “I though we didn’t have any tests today.” “You don’t,” Dr. Kadrid said his smile slipping. “Then go away,” Andrik said reaching for the book. With a sigh Dr. Kadrid nodded. The nearest orderly immediately grabbed Andrik by the wrist and hauled him off the couch. A second orderly immediately grabbed his other arm and the two of them forced the boy to the floor. “LET GO OF ME!” Andrik shouted as he struggled against the two men. As Andrik continued to struggle and growl Andreasa slowly rose to her feet.
“What’s going on?” she asked.
“It has been decided,” Dr. Kadrid said ignoring the commotion on the floor beside him, “That you are to be moved to another facility.”
“Why?”
“For more intensive testing and to get you away from #237, letting you two interact is a risk we are no longer willing to take.”
“Andrik would never hurt me.”
“He is openly hostile to everyone but you. How much do you think it would take to make that change?”
“Andrik. Would never. Hurt me.”
Dr. Kadrid sighed and nodded his head again. One of the orderlies gently placed a hand on Andreasa’s shoulder. “We really had hoped things wouldn’t have to go like this,” Dr. Kadrid said almost regretfully.
While three orderlies remained to keep an eye on Andrik the doctor and the others guided Andreasa out of the room. “Really number 223 eventually you’ll understand that this was the best course of action,” Dr. Kadrid said as he left the room. As he spoke both of the psychics had a brief flash of what was planed for the girl. The only clear image was of a very large knife. “Andrik!” Andreasa called out suddenly fearful.
Andrik went into a rage at both the vision and Andreasa’s call for help. “GET OFF ME!” he roared. At the same time the third orderly grabbed the other two by the hair and slammed their heads together. Before the man could realize what he’d just done Andrik was off the floor his palm slamming into the man’s jaw. The man hit the floor with a thud and didn’t look to be getting back up.

Hearing the commotion back in the room Dr. Kadrid said, “You get the girl out of here. You two go see what’s happening.” The two orderlies turned around just in time to see Andrik come charging out of the room. The young man ran right into one of the orderlies knocking the wind from the man’s lungs tackling him to the ground. Andrik rolled away from the orderly before he could recover and get a hold of him. Finding himself lying on his back in front of the second orderly, Andrik lashed out with his foot, kicking the man in the crotch. The man doubled over and collapsed to the floor. Andrik then rolled back toward the first orderly and brought his hand down in a chop on the man’s throat just has the man was getting back up.
Tearing his eyes away from the display of violence, Dr. Kadrid turned to see the last orderly standing frozen beside Andreasa. “What are you doing?” the doctor shouted, “I said get the girl out of here!” The pounding of feet was the only warning of Andrik’s approach and the doctor cringed at the expected blow. Instead Dr. Kadrid watched as Andrik ran past him and slammed into the last orderly sending the man sprawling to the floor. Breathing heavily he grabbed Andreasa by the hand and the pair began to run. As the two psychics disappeared around a corner Andreasa shot a last icy look back at the doctor. the girl’s voice echoed in the doctor’s head.
